/// A completion contributor used to suggest replacing partial identifiers
/// inside a class declaration with templates for inherited members.
class OverrideContributor implements DartCompletionContributor {
@override
Future<List<CompletionSuggestion>> computeSuggestions(
DartCompletionRequest request, SuggestionBuilder builder) async {
var target = request.target;
var containingNode = target.containingNode;
var classDecl =
containingNode.thisOrAncestorOfType<ClassOrMixinDeclaration>();
if (classDecl == null) {
return const <CompletionSuggestion>[];
}
if (containingNode.inClassMemberBody) {
return const <CompletionSuggestion>[];
}
var comment = containingNode.thisOrAncestorOfType<Comment>();
if (target.isCommentText || comment != null) {
return const <CompletionSuggestion>[];
}
var sourceRange = _getTargetSourceRange(target);
sourceRange ??= range.startOffsetEndOffset(request.offset, 0);
var inheritance = InheritanceManager3();
// Generate a collection of inherited members
var classElem = classDecl.declaredElement;
var classType = _thisType(request, classElem);
var interface = inheritance.getInterface(classType);
var interfaceMap = interface.map;
var namesToOverride =
_namesToOverride(classElem.librarySource.uri, interface);
// Build suggestions
var suggestions = <CompletionSuggestion>[];
for (var name in namesToOverride) {
var element = interfaceMap[name];
// Gracefully degrade if the overridden element has not been resolved.
if (element.returnType != null) {
var invokeSuper = interface.isSuperImplemented(name);
var suggestion =
await _buildSuggestion(request, sourceRange, element, invokeSuper);
if (suggestion != null) {
suggestions.add(suggestion);
}
}
}
return suggestions;
}
/// Build a suggestion to replace [sourceRange] in the given [request] with an
/// override of the given [element].
Future<CompletionSuggestion> _buildSuggestion(
DartCompletionRequest request,
SourceRange sourceRange,
ExecutableElement element,
bool invokeSuper) async {
var displayTextBuffer = StringBuffer();
var builder = DartChangeBuilder(request.result.session);
await builder.addFileEdit(request.result.path, (builder) {
builder.addReplacement(sourceRange, (builder) {
builder.writeOverride(
element,
displayTextBuffer: displayTextBuffer,
invokeSuper: invokeSuper,
);
});
});
var fileEdits = builder.sourceChange.edits;
if (fileEdits.length != 1) return null;
var sourceEdits = fileEdits[0].edits;
if (sourceEdits.length != 1) return null;
var replacement = sourceEdits[0].replacement;
var completion = replacement.trim();
var overrideAnnotation = '@override';
if (_hasOverride(request.target.containingNode) &&
completion.startsWith(overrideAnnotation)) {
completion = completion.substring(overrideAnnotation.length).trim();
}
if (completion.isEmpty) {
return null;
}
var selectionRange = builder.selectionRange;
if (selectionRange == null) {
return null;
}
var offsetDelta = sourceRange.offset + replacement.indexOf(completion);
var displayText =
displayTextBuffer.isNotEmpty ? displayTextBuffer.toString() : null;
var suggestion = CompletionSuggestion(
CompletionSuggestionKind.OVERRIDE,
request.useNewRelevance ? Relevance.override : DART_RELEVANCE_HIGH,
completion,
selectionRange.offset - offsetDelta,
selectionRange.length,
element.hasDeprecated,
false,
displayText: displayText);
suggestion.element = protocol.convertElement(element);
return suggestion;
}
